Alice Janigro

Social Media Manager

she/her

Alice Janigro is Roosevelt’s social media manager, leading social media strategy across the organization as a part of the communications team.


As social media manager, Alice Janigro leads social media strategy across the organization and supports the organization’s broader digital strategy. Alice evaluates, plans, organizes, and coordinates social content to amplify Roosevelt’s messages, spokespeople, research, programs, and events. She supports the release and promotion of Roosevelt’s publications across social media platforms, and helps implement and track metrics of success for Roosevelt’s digital communications.

Alice started as an intern with the Roosevelt Network in the New York City office. She then worked as Roosevelt’s communications manager, supporting press, media, and social media functions of the organization to help to promote Roosevelt’s post-neoliberal work and worldview in the media. Prior to working at Roosevelt, Alice worked as a field organizer with Elizabeth Warren’s reelection campaign and the Massachusetts Democratic Party. She has also interned in the offices of Sen. Sherrod Brown (D-OH) and Sen. Elizabeth Warren (D-MA). She is a 2019 graduate of Tufts University, where she received a BA in international relations with a focus on international trade, and a minor in Italian. At Tufts, Alice worked as a research assistant for the Tufts Labor Lab, participated in student dance groups, and was part of the Jonathan M. Tisch College of Civic Life.
